comparison of green tea [twinings®] and matcha tea [now real tea®] effect on re-mineralization of artificially- induced initial enamel caries of human teeth: study 𝑖𝑛 𝑣𝑖𝑡𝑟𝑜

Decay can develop at any point throughout lifetime. matcha tea contains significant amounts of minerals; it had the highest concentration of fluoride among other types of tea. this in vitro study aimed to compare the effect of green tea and matcha on re-mineralizing enamel caries-like lesions. in this in vitro study, forty intact premolar teeth [extracted for orthodontic treatment] were collected; acrylic resin was poured into sliced plastic rings. in the middle of the ring, teeth crowns were placed, with the labial surface visible. a 4x4 mm window was prepared for measurements. samples were placed into tubes contains 20 ml of de-mineralizing solution for 72 hours to produce demineralization. afterwards, they were randomly separated into four categories. group 1: deionized water, group 2: sodium fluoride solution, group 3: matcha solution; and group 4: green tea solution; ten teeth in each group. samples were soaked in 20 ml of the tested solution for four minutes. the processes were performed daily for one week. samples were evaluated using a vicker hardness testing machine. a significant difference was found between baselines followed by after treatment [p < 0.05] except with de-ionized water. a non-significant difference was found between the tested group: green tea was showing the highest mean value [107.101], followed by matcha [104.213] and sodium fluoride [92.524]. a significant difference was found when compared these groups with deionized water. there was no significant difference between matcha and green tea.
